Bulletin


No. G- 07/05
– General

Licensing changes for third quarter 2005


The Financial Services Commission of Ontario (FSCO) is releasing information on the disposition of applications for licences and licence changes received during the third quarter, July 1, 2005 to September 30, 2005. The applications relate to individuals and organizations in financial services sectors under FSCO’s jurisdiction, including insurance, credit unions/caisses populaires, co-operatives, trust and loan companies, and mortgage brokers.

In addition, FSCO is responsible for regulating pension plans registered in the province. For more information on pensions or any of the other financial services sectors regulated by FSCO, visit its website at www.fsco.gov.on.ca.

INSURANCE – Agents and Adjusters

During the third quarter of 2005, FSCO reviewed and approved 1,282 new individual agent licences and 2,897 agent renewals. For 86 per cent of applications received, FSCO completed its review and issued licences in 5 days or less.

In addition, FSCO approved and processed 99 new corporate agent licences, 226 corporate renewals, 22 new individual adjuster licences, 431 individual adjuster renewals, and 20 corporate adjuster renewals. There was one new corporate adjuster licence application.

CREDIT UNIONS/CAISSES POPULAIRES

During the period under review, FSCO did not receive applications for new incorporations. Ten credit unions/caisses populaires applied for and received approval for lending licence changes. Lending categories include unsecured, personal, bridge, aggregate, mortgage, agricultural, and commercial lending increases of varying amounts.

Two credit unions were approved to merge through amalgamation, and one credit union was approved to merge through transfer of assets as follows:

Amalgamation:

Lambton Financial Credit Union Limited and Dow Chemical Employees (Sarnia) Credit Union Limited amalgamated effective September 30, 2005, forming Lambton Financial Credit Union Limited.

CO-OPERATIVES

During the third quarter, there were six incorporations, seven offering statements, and one amendment.

TRUST/LOAN CORPORATIONS

On July 1, 2005, Desjardins Trust Inc., formerly a Quebec incorporated company registered in Ontario, was granted continuance as a federally incorporated trust company and entered in the trust companies register.

On August 3, 2005, the Superintendent issued a letter to Industrial Alliance Trust Inc., formerly under the name Industrial Alliance-Trust Company, releasing the company from its June 29, 2004 Undertaking effective March 2, 2005.

On August 3, 2005, the Superintendent issued a letter to Laurentian Trust of Canada Inc. releasing the company from its June 29, 2004 Undertaking effective June 30, 2005.

On August 3, 2005, the Superintendent issued a letter to Desjardins Trust Inc. releasing the company from its June 29, 2004 Undertaking effective July 1, 2005.

MORTGAGE BROKERS

During this period, FSCO issued 217 certificates of registration for mortgage brokers.
